I've been battling this for over a year. Any suggestions???
This is a 2000 Ford Explorer. 4.0 SOHC with 88K mi. - Originally a Canadian car, now in Washington state. It runs great but idles crummy, much more in gear, then in park. It sort of vibrates, and shudders a little. Just enough to make things rattle. Never dies though.
ALLDATA indicates idle speed spec. is: Hot Idle 670-750 Scan tool shows avg. idle is 645 in gear. ALLDATA indicates - low idle, look at fuel, and or ignition? ALLDATA indicates - vehicle has foul resistant injectors, should not require cleaning.
ALLDATA indicates - Fuel spec. 30 - 65 lbs. Tested = Idle in gear 65 - 69 / Idle in park 66 - 68 (never drops to 30) Leak down test - Fuel system dropped 15lbs. immediatly, then held for several minutes. This vehicle uses a mechanically regulated non - return type fuel pump
88k Miles 20k ago changed, plug wires, fuel filter. Last 6 months changed, spark plugs, IAC, air filter, cleaned the MAF sensor, two applications of injector cleaner, and cleaned the throttle body.I think something is causing it to idle too slow. Do you think a slightly high fuel pressure will do that? Also fuel pressure spec indicates 30 to 65. This car doesn't drop to 30. but I don't see how it could, because the system uses a spring loaded bypass at the pump for regulation.
